The event will be held at the exciting new First Light Pavilion, Jodrell Bank, an architecturally stunning building on the site of the Lovell Telescope. Such an amazing venue is a superb setting for keynote speaker, former Red Arrows’ squadron commander, Andy Wyatt.

The new CIMA President, Sarah Ghosh, will be attending along with Stephen Edwards, chairman, North West England and North Wales. Andy will share his expertise on team-working from and you can read his impressive career details in the biography below.

    Andy Wyatt is widely known for his career as a Red Arrows Display Pilot and Royal Air Force Pilot. Having navigated some of the most hostile environments known to man, Andy has continually demonstrated his skills for teamwork, leadership, planning and operations.

    With years of experience on the front line, Andy now shares his experiences in the Royal Air Force and the life lessons he learnt along the way.

    Aged 18 years old, Andy made the life changing decision to enrol for the Royal Air Force, completing his training and being given the opportunity to fly the English Electric Lightning and intercept Russian aircraft during the Cold War.

    Andy rose through the ranks and was ultimately selected to be a pilot in the Red Arrows Display team. With the Red Arrows, Andy became the Hawk Squadron Commander, a Deputy Chief Flying Instructor and Hawk Fleet Manager. During his service, Andy was also given the opportunity to display Hawk, Vampire, Venom, Antonov An2, Hunter, Extra 300, Yak 52 and Boeing Stearman aircraft.

    Having enjoyed many successful years as part of the Royal Air Force and the RAF Aerobatic Team, Andy retired from the forces in 2014.

    However, Andy didn’t leave the skies for good, and went on to become the Captain of a Boeing 747 for British Airways.

    After an impressive 22 years in commercial aviation, Andy left British Airways and went on to become the Squadron Leader of The Honourable Company of Air Pilots. Currently he is the Chief Pilot for Longtail Aviation, a true testament to his knowledge of planes and the great blue skies.
